Ghana Bar Association Mourns Victims of August 6 Helicopter Crash

The Ghana Bar Association (GBA) has joined the nation in mourning the eight Ghanaians who tragically lost their lives in the August 6, 2025 helicopter crash while en route to Obuasi for a national assignment.

In a statement dated August 7, 2025, and signed by National President Mrs. Efua Ghartey and National Secretary Kwaku Gyau Baffour, the GBA expressed “profound sorrow” over the incident, describing the deceased as “patriotic Ghanaians” who died in the line of duty.

The association extended heartfelt condolences to the families of the victims and the people of Ghana, noting the nation’s deep loss. “May the Father of our Lord Jesus Christ, the Father of compassion and the God of all comfort, who comforts us in all our troubles, comfort the bereaved families. Our prayers are with the bereaved families,” the statement said.

The GBA also prayed for the eternal rest of the departed souls, adding that their service to the nation will be remembered.

The fatal crash, which claimed the lives of two cabinet ministers, other government officials, and three military officers, has sparked nationwide grief and tributes from various institutions and individuals across the country.
